opentype.js is een open source JavaScript-bibliotheek dat lettertype informatie van de bron kan ontleden, wat betekent dat het lettertype zelf bestanden.
De bibliotheek ondersteunt OpenType en TrueType-lettertypen, waarmee ontwikkelaars gegevens, zoals te lezen:
- font glyph paden
- font glyph punten
- font metrics
- spatiëring gegevens
Naast deze, de bibliotheek ondersteunt ook OpenType (glyf) vormen, PostScript (CFF) vormen, en composiet glyphs.
Zodra deze gegevens geëxporteerd vanuit het lettertype, kunnen ze worden in JavaScript aangepast en eventueel terug naar een lettertype bestand geschreven. Dit stelt ontwikkelaars in staat om nieuwe lettertype-bestanden te maken met behulp van JavaScript alleen.
opentype.js werkt met zowel client-side (browsers) en server-side (Node.js) omgevingen.
Wat is nieuw in deze release .
- problemen bij het exporteren / subsetting TrueType-fonts
- Verbeter validness van geëxporteerde lettertypen.
- Empty paden (denk: ruimte). Niet langer een enkele closePath commando bevatten
- problemen oplossen met het exporteren fonts met TrueType half punt waarden.
- Maak de interne byte parsing algoritmen als opentype._parse.
Wat is nieuw in versie 0.4.9:.
- Problemen bij het exporteren / subsetting TrueType-fonts
- Verbeter validness van geëxporteerde lettertypen.
- Empty paden (denk: ruimte). Niet langer een enkele closePath commando bevatten
- problemen oplossen met het exporteren fonts met TrueType half punt waarden.
- Maak de interne byte parsing algoritmen als opentype._parse.
Wat is nieuw in versie 0.4.7:.
- Problemen bij het exporteren / subsetting TrueType-fonts
- Verbeter validness van geëxporteerde lettertypen.
- Empty paden (denk: ruimte). Niet langer een enkele closePath commando bevatten
- problemen oplossen met het exporteren fonts met TrueType half punt waarden.
- Maak de interne byte parsing algoritmen als opentype._parse.
Eisen
- Javascript nodig op client side
- Node.js voor server-side-omgevingen
Reacties niet gevonden